An X12 validator begins by interpreting the file. Parsing turns raw X12 segments and elements into structured data; validation then checks that parsed content against the supported structure and rules enabled for the detected transaction. EDI file validation combines enabled structural validation with transaction-specific validation. Coverage varies by transaction family and supported implementation version; each category describes implemented checks, not exhaustive implementation-guide coverage.
Checks supported ISA/IEA, GS/GE, and ST/SE pairing, control values, and counts—for example, an SE segment count that differs from the parsed transaction.
Flags implemented requiredness and occurrence rules, such as a required transaction segment or element missing in its supported context.
Reviews enabled loop, parent-child, and contextual ownership rules—for example, member, claim, service, or benefit information attached to the wrong supported scope.
Checks supported date shapes and calendar values plus counts, amounts, quantities, ranges, and consistency—for example, an invalid date or malformed decimal.
Reviews implemented qualifier and code semantics plus selected identifier formats, such as an unknown supported code or invalid NPI where an XX qualifier applies.
Checks selected mapped-output consistency and surfaces reported 999 or 277CA issues where applicable without treating recipient-reported content as certification.
Scope: A file can pass the enabled checks and still be rejected by a payer, clearinghouse, or trading partner because companion guides and business rules may add requirements. Validation does not guarantee recipient acceptance.
Common EDI validation errors include X12 syntax errors, required-content defects, invalid values, and contextual inconsistencies. These synthetic examples reflect issue classes the current validator can report; they contain no customer or patient data.
Mismatched envelope controls, incorrect segment counts, missing required segments, or incomplete required elements can prevent dependable processing.
Malformed dates, impossible calendar values, invalid decimals, inconsistent counts, or unsupported signed-value situations can produce targeted Errors or Warnings.
Unknown enabled codes, incorrect qualifiers, broken parent relationships, or data attached to the wrong claim, service, member, or benefit context can be reported.
999/277CA reported errors, contradictory acknowledgment counts, duplicate output identities, and selected edited-output inconsistencies remain distinguishable for review.
